Patricia “Pat” Clarke
March 17, 1947 – September 10, 2025

Patricia Donna McNabb was born in Eston, Saskatchewan to Helen (Collins) and Donald McNabb on March 17, 1947. This made St. Patrick’s Day a special holiday in her family. She grew up with her younger brother Jack on the farm at Isham and Tyner, Saskatchewan. She started school at Tyner and graduated from Eston High School in 1965.

Pat then went to Business College in Saskatoon and used her training to work in law offices and banks as well as community groups for most of her life.

In 1966, Pat married Gerald Clarke in Saskatoon where they both worked before returning to Tyner to farm with the McNabbs. They lived in Eston and Isham. In 1972 the young family made the first of several moves in Gerald’s grain buying career to Rosetown, SK. They had two daughters, Laureen & Lindsay. They continued to raise their family in Vermilion and Provost, Alberta. The two of them also lived in Viking and Vegreville for a few years.

Laureen married Jack Rennie of Hayter and Lindsay married Warren Heisler of Cadogan and eventually Pat and Gerald retired and moved back to Provost in 2003 to spend more time with their grandchildren, Nelson, Drake and Karlin. A special treat for Pat in recent years was getting to know Ty, Tori and Bri and including them in the family; but becoming a great nana was a title she treasured with Sutton and Rocker.

Being diagnosed with lung and heart disease five years ago was the beginning of a marathon Pat did not have time to prepare for. She and Gerald moved to Hillcrest Lodge in 2023, and she often said it was her last all inclusive. Her entire family was able to spend so much quality time with her that they will always cherish.

Pat is lovingly remembered by her husband of 59 years Gerald, her daughters and their families, Laureen and Jack, Drake (Tori), Karlin (Ty); Lindsay and Warren, Nelson (Brianna) and their children, Sutton and Rocker; her brother, Jack McNabb (Terryl Essery); in-laws, Maynard Clarke (†Elaine), Maureen Kresak (†Ivan), Pat King (†Harvey), and Chris Clarke (Valerie) as well as numerous extended family members, nieces and nephews, and friends.

Pat was predeceased by her parents, Don and Helen McNabb; parents in law, Earl and Berniece Clarke; an infant son; and her nieces, Megan and Samantha.
